Though most chemicals in cosmetics pose little or absolutely no danger, several have been associated with substantial medical problems, such as cancer, reproductive and neurological harm, and developmental delays. Cosmetic chemicals invade a person's body through the skin, inhalation, ingestion and internal use, and cause similar risks as food chemicals, per this site.

Chemicals linked to cancer can be found in water, food, and various other common products. But, no classification of consumer products is accountable to less government direction than cosmetics and other personal products, including Victoria's Secret Beauty Rush Color Shine Gloss Illuminating. While many of the contaminants and chemicals in cosmetics and personal care products probably present very little risk, your exposure to some has been linked to major health issues, such as cancer.
